Description

This spacious, semi-detached property enjoys a corner plot on a quiet cul-de-sac in the sought-after area of Cawston. The property is situated in close proximity to a range of parks and picturesque walks including the Cawston Greenway. It is conveniently located 5 minutes walking distance to a local parade of shops (including local supermarket, take-aways and hairdressers), and is within 5 minutes walking distance to the highly regarded Cawston Grange primary school.

The property benefits from a private garden which backs onto the garden of another property, making it private a great place to relax. To the side and rear is a secure, gated driveway and detached garage offering off-road parking.

The beautifully presented living accommodation is arranged over two floors with the ground floor comprising an entrance hallway, guest WC, spacious lounge with French doors opening to the garden, a utility room and modern fitted kitchen/diner with integral appliances, breakfast bar and ample space for dining.

The first floor features a landing area, four well-proportioned bedrooms, with bedrooms one and two benefiting from built-in storage, a family bathroom, and en-suite shower room to the master bedroom.

The property further benefits from double glazing, gas central heating and neutral decoration throughout, allowing ready to move into accommodation.

Located at the southwest of Rugby, the highly sought-after suburban village of Cawston is well served by a range of local shops and amenities, and excellent transport links to include regular bus routes, easy access to the region's central motorway networks (M1/M6 and M45) and is just a ten-minute drive from Rugby train station, which operates mainline services to London Euston in just 47 minutes.
Cawston is situated near two beautiful and vibrant villages: Bilton and Dunchurch. The various amenities within the two neighbouring villages include a wide range of highly regarded nurseries and outstanding schools, supermarkets, pubs, restaurants, doctor's surgeries, churches, dentist, vet, chemists, hairdressers, coffee shops, butchers, and takeaways.

Within and surrounding Cawston are a wide range of excellent schools. Cawston Grange Primary School is just within 5 minutes walking distance, as well as excellent primary schools within Dunchurch and Bilton. Secondary school choices include two well-known Grammar Schools and a great choice of comprehensive schooling. Two independent secondary schools include the globally renowned Rugby School and highly reputable Princethorpe College.
